Description Nicolas Fella 2023-10-01 13:46:09 UTC
ST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Open tablet KCM in systemsettings
2. Change any of the shortcut settings
3. Close systemsettings
4. Discard pending settings
5. Open KCM again

OBSERVED RESULT
The change was applied

EXPECTED RESULT
The change was discarded

[kshortcuteditor] Undo pending changes on destruction

Currently one has to manually call undo() to discard pending changes when being done with the widget.

This is error-prone because it's easy to forget or cause use-after-free issues when calling undo() on an already deleted editor.

Instead automatically undo() on destruction
